MEDI-CAL MANAGED HEALTH CARE PLAN

1600 Green Hills Road, Suite 101, Scotts Valley, CA 95066-4981

Provides needed health care services for low-income individuals including families with children, seniors, persons with disabilities, foster care, pregnant women, and low-income people with diseases such as asthma, diabetes, tuberculosis, breast cancer, or HIV/AIDS. Eligibility is determined by the Santa Cruz County Health Services department.

Transportation Services

If you are medically unable to use a car, bus, train or taxi, the Alliance will arrange transportation for you. This type of transportation is called non-emergency medical transportation (NEMT).

NEMT is for when you need extra help or special transportation needs. Examples of NEMT are an ambulance, wheelchair van or air transport.

Transportation to medical services by passenger car, taxicab or other forms of public or private transportation is called non-medical transportation (NMT). NMT is available to members who need help getting to medical services. Members must show that they do not have any other transportation options.

IN HOME SUPPORTIVE SERVICES (IHSS)

500 Westridge Drive, Watsonville, CA 95076

The County of Santa Cruz Human Services Department's In Home Supportive Services (IHSS) program supports safe independent living for low-income frail elderly adults and disabled persons of all ages. County IHSS services assist people to apply for and determine eligibility to receive and access IHSS. The IHSS Public Authority - a separate partner agency - is the employer of record for IHSS providers, providing assistance to IHSS recipient consumers on how to interview, hire and supervise a care providers, helping improve service delivery for low income seniors and disabled individuals of all ages who are enrolled in IHSS.

Data provided by
211 Bay Area

IN HOME SUPPORTIVE SERVICES PUBLIC AUTHORITY

500 Westridge Drive, Watsonville, CA 95076
The Public Authority is responsible for enrolling caregivers into the In-Home Supportive Services Program, provides ongoing training to IHSS caregivers, provide free supplies to IHSS caregivers and manage a registry of IHSS caregivers. The Public Authority assists IHSS recipients that need a caregiver with referrals of potential caregivers.

OUTREACH PROGRAM

1430 Freedom Boulevard, Suite C, Watsonville, CA 95076

Our Outreach Program eliminates transportation as a barrier to care for underserved Santa Cruz County residents at many venues, including schools, skilled nursing facilities (SNFs), and our one-chair Outreach Clinic at Housing Matters in Santa Cruz. Our partnerships provide patients who might not otherwise get access to dental services to the treatment they need. At our outreach sites, our staff delivers oral health evaluations including x-rays, and procedures such as cleanings and fluoride varnish. Those patients who require more complex care are referred back to our clinic. Dientes provides oral health education and preventive services in six school districts (Pajaro Valley Unified, Live Oak, San Lorenzo Valley, Soquel Unified, Santa Cruz City & Santa Cruz County Office of Education) at 30+ schools. The program has been a huge success since its inception in 2009.
